Steve Buscemi is an American actor, director and producer who first gained notice for his role as a man living with AIDS in the film Parting Glances (1986). His breakout role in film was in his role as Mr. Pink in Quentin Tarantino 's Reservoir Dogs (1992).
Steve Buscemi. Actor: Fargo. Steve Buscemi was born in Brooklyn, New York, to Dorothy (Wilson), a restaurant hostess, and John Buscemi, a sanitation worker. He is of Italian (father) and English, Dutch, and Irish (mother) descent.

The 65-year-old actor has appeared in nearly 175 films and television series throughout his 40+ year acting career and is slated to star in the dramatic comedy The Shallow Tale of a Writer Who Decided to Write about a Serial Killer from Turkish director Tolga Karaçelik.
